I think the Mk1 is a sleeper. Doesn't get a ton of love. Not as cool as a Becker or a KA-BAR. But when you put it into use. It reall shines. It's not too big, or too heavy, or too small. Like Goldie said, it's just right!

My Kraton handled version is top notch. It truelly is an overlooked sleeper. The FFG and overall blade geometry makes it a real kean slicer though it maintains enough stock thickness to be used hard.
